The baskets are going to be put in the ground today.
I know that Shan and the Wellington boys are going to play Saturday at 1:00.
The tees will be marked with flags for a while. So if you go and play it may be a little hard to find your way around.
The course makes a figure 8. The first hole is next to the big gazebo on the far side of the ponds.
The first hole will tee to the East that should get you on the right track. After you play the hole over the water, you will walk across the street and play to the east again.
After you make your way back to the gazebo, you will then head to the west for the back 9 loop.
If you have any ideas on tee locations, post them here. The baskets are set where they are going to be located. Some of them have been changed by the parks department.
